Transaction 376d62c9922f8a4e1f0dc9ed586d8a1291ed16e348f1f5992874b120e91c852d
1 Input
2 Outputs
- 376d62c9922f8a4e1f0dc9ed586d8a1291ed16e348f1f5992874b120e91c852d:0
- 376d62c9922f8a4e1f0dc9ed586d8a1291ed16e348f1f5992874b120e91c852d:1
value 182676493982
address mjfAsRMdjggoGMCg2TSwwPK4bdByGRih4H
value 195072056
address 2NBMEXzgT6WLkzes1oARKBK872tLoucqy17